disparagingly
adv. 以貶抑的口吻,以輕視的態度
If you are disparaging about someone or something, or make disparaging comments about them, you say things which show that you do not have a good opinion of them.
He was critical of the people, disparaging of their crude manners...
他對那些人很有看法,看不起他們粗俗的舉止。
The Minister was alleged to have made disparaging remarks about the rest of the Cabinet.
據說這位部長髮表了一些貶低其他內閣成員的言論。
1. in a disparaging manner;
Do not talk disparagingly about your company in public.
不要公開詆譭你的公司。
These mythological figures are described disparagingly as belonging only to a story.
這些神話人物被輕蔑地描述為“僅在傳說中出現”的人物.
In his memoirs he often speaks disparagingly about the private sector.
在他的回憶錄裡面他經常輕蔑的談及私營(商業)部門.
